We are recruiting Registered Mental Health Nurses (RMNs) to support services across Bristol. This role involves delivering high-quality mental health care across a variety of inpatient and community settings.

Responsibilities

  • Deliver person-centred mental health care
  • Conduct mental health and risk assessments
  • Develop and implement care plans
  • Administer and monitor medication
  • Support patients in crisis and acute settings
  • Work within multidisciplinary teams
  • Maintain accurate clinical records
  • Follow safeguarding and clinical governance procedures

Qualifications

  • Valid NMC registration as an RMN
  • Minimum 6–12 months UK mental health experience
  • Right to work in the UK
  • Enhanced DBS (or willingness to obtain)
  • Up‑to‑date mandatory training
  • Strong communication and clinical skills, experience in acute or community mental health settings
  • Knowledge of safeguarding and risk management
  • Ability to work under pressure
  • Strong interpersonal skills

How to prepare for a job interview at TEAM Inc.

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your mental health knowledge, especially around person-centred care and risk assessments. Familiarise yourself with the latest practices in both inpatient and community settings, as this will show that you're not just qualified but also genuinely interested in the field.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Be ready to discuss your previous roles and how they relate to the responsibilities of an RMN. Think of specific examples where you've successfully supported patients in crisis or worked within multidisciplinary teams. This will help demonstrate your hands-on experience and problem-solving skills.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ions about the role and the team you'll be working with. This shows that you're engaged and serious about the position. You might ask about the types of cases you'll handle or how the team approaches safeguarding and clinical governance.

✨Stay Calm Under Pressure

Interviews can be nerve-wracking, especially for a role that involves working under pressure. Practice some relaxation techniques beforehand, and remember to take a deep breath if you feel anxious during the interview. Showing that you can maintain composure will reflect well on your ability to handle challenging situations in the job.
